CRTO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

68 of the 3,479 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Criteo (CRTO)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$550M — down 21% from $697M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 35 funds closed out of CRTO and 22 opened new positions — a net loss of 13 holders — while 18 trimmed existing stakes and 21 added.

The largest buyer was Bank of Montreal, opening a new position worth an estimated $21.6M. The largest seller was AllianceBernstein, exiting entirely with an estimated $53.8M sold.
